The REAL reason Tommy Fury is banned from appearing in Molly-Mae Hague's Prime Video series Behind It All revealed
Tommy Fury is banned from appearing in Molly-Mae Hague 's show Behind It All despite the couple rekindling their romance.
The deal means Tommy isn't able to film for streamer Prime Video as his series, which is being captured for BBC Three and iPlayer, promises to follow his life as he overcomes his struggles with alcohol and backlash from his breakup with Molly. The Prime Video documentary, produced by the team behind Netflix's At Home With the Furys, was set to follow the buildup of Molly and Tommy's wedding before they unexpectedly split in August 2024. After revealing that his relationship with Molly collapsed because of struggles with alcohol, it's believed Tommy delves into further detail about his mental health and how a boxing injury led to the toughest chapter of his life.
